Inside Horton’s MLB Debut

The anticipation around Cade Horton's major-league debut reached a fever pitch leading up to the Cubs’ weekend series against the Mets in New York. According to the Chicago Tribune, Horton was summoned from the Triple-A Iowa Cubs following an impressive stretch. His call-up became official when ace Shota Imanaga landed on the injured list, giving Horton the perfect opportunity to showcase his talent in the rotation.

Horton’s performance in Triple-A left little room for doubt. With a 1.24 ERA through six starts and precise command, he’s proven he belongs. Cubs’ manager Craig Counsell emphasized that Horton had "earned the opportunity" and was "pitching really well." What The Cubs and Their Fans Can Expect

Expectations for Cade Horton are high. As highlighted by MLB.com’s analyst, Horton is the top Cubs pitching prospect since Mark Prior. His fastball-slider combination, with increased velocity this season, gives him an edge. If he adapts quickly at the major-league level, he could become a long-term asset in Chicago’s rotation.

Of course, growth is never linear. Horton has work to do to further develop his changeup and groundball rate. Still, many believe that with experience, these improvement areas will be addressed. For fantasy baseball players, Yahoo Sports noted that while Horton may experience rookie inconsistency, his upside makes him a valuable pickup.
